SULFUR | Sulfur is a popular mineral that forms as a soft precipitate near volcanic vents and springs. This bright yellow mineral has a distinct smell and unusual streak color
GREAT FOR GEOLOGY CLASSROOMS | Ideal for identification & classification exercises. Great for students learning about streak tests - sulfur leaves an unexpected white streak. This set of six samples is excellent for group study and examination
